Many resources created as part of managed apps in cozystack (pods, secrets, etc) do not carry predictable labels that unambiguously indicate which app originally triggered their creation. Some resources are managed by controllers and other custom resources and this indirection can lead to loss of information. Other controllers sometimes simply do not allow setting labels on controlled resources and the latter do not inherit labels from the owner. This patch implements a webhook that sidesteps this problem with a universal solution. On creation of a pod/secret/PVC etc it walks through the owner references until a HelmRelease is found that can be matched with a managed app dynamically registered in the Cozystack API server. Managed Nginx-based HTTP Cache Service
The Nginx-based HTTP caching service is designed to optimize web traffic and enhance web application performance. This service combines custom-built Nginx instances with HAProxy for efficient caching and load balancing.
Deployment information
The Nginx instances include the following modules and features:
- VTS module for statistics
- Integration with ip2location
- Integration with ip2proxy
- Support for 51Degrees
- Cache purge functionality
HAproxy plays a vital role in this setup by directing incoming traffic to specific Nginx instances based on a consistent hash calculated from the URL. Each Nginx instance includes a Persistent Volume Claim (PVC) for storing cached content, ensuring fast and reliable access to frequently used resources.

Parameter examples and reference
resources and resourcesPreset
resources sets explicit CPU and memory configurations for each replica.
When left empty, the preset defined in resourcesPreset is applied.
resources:
cpu: 4000m
memory: 4Gi
resourcesPreset sets named CPU and memory configurations for each replica.
This setting is ignored if the corresponding resources value is set.

endpoints
endpoints is a flat list of IP addresses:
endpoints:
- 10.100.3.1:80
- 10.100.3.11:80
- 10.100.3.2:80
- 10.100.3.12:80
- 10.100.3.3:80
- 10.100.3.13:80
